What is GST Return Filing?

GST return filing is the process where businesses submit details of sales, purchases, tax collected, and input tax credit to the GST portal using forms like GSTR-1 and GSTR-3B on a monthly or quarterly basis.

Think of GST return filing as a monthly report card of your business transactions.

You tell the government:

  • How much you sold
  • How much GST you collected
  • How much GST you paid on purchases
  • How much tax you still need to pay

If done correctly, you avoid penalties and keep your business clean

Types of GST Returns

Return TypeWho FilesPurposeDue Date
GSTR-1Regular taxpayersSales details (outward supplies)11th of next month / Quarterly
GSTR-3BRegular taxpayersSummary + tax payment20th / 22nd / 24th
CMP-08Composition dealersQuarterly tax payment18th of next month
GSTR-4CompositionAnnual returnOnce a year
GSTR-9Regular taxpayersAnnual summaryOnce a year

👉 Missing these deadlines leads to late fees + interest.

Input Tax Credit (ITC) – Most Important Concept

This is where most businesses make mistakes.

What is ITC?

It’s the tax you already paid on purchases that you can deduct.

Example:

  • GST collected: ₹1,00,000
  • GST paid on purchases: ₹60,000

👉 You pay only ₹40,000

Important Rule:

You can claim ITC only if it appears in GSTR-2B

GST Return Filing for Small Businesses

If your turnover is below ₹5 crore:

  • File GSTR-1 quarterly
  • Pay tax monthly
  • File GSTR-3B quarterly

👉 Good option for small businesses to reduce workload
